What are the correct color seat belts for an 11C built 69 with 721 interior?  Also, are there any parts of the interior that are anything other than the medium "puke" green?  I've noticed some components, like the dash pad, seem to only be offered in dark green while others are black only.  Is this correct or do you buy what is offered and dye everything medium green?   I have nothing to start with and need to buy a complete interior. Any suggestions or advice would be welcomed.
Title: Re: Correct Seat Belt Color
Post by: JohnZ on June 13, 2006, 02:36:57 PM
Unless it was ordered specifically with deluxe belts (which were a stand-alone option and weren't part of any other interior package), it would have black standard seat/shoulder belts.

Thanks again John.   So no matter what color interior you had, unless you ordered deluxe belts, you got black?
Title: Re: Correct Seat Belt Color
Post by: JohnZ on June 15, 2006, 01:38:39 AM
Thanks again John. So no matter what color interior you had, unless you ordered deluxe belts, you got black?

Yup - my '69Z has the original Z87deluxe midnight green interior, and the original seat and shoulder belts - standard black.
